Founded in 1846, today HP Hood is one of the largest and most trusted food and beverage manufacturers in the United States. Our portfolio of national and super-regional brands and licensed products includes Hood, Heluva Good, Lactaid, Blue Diamond Almond Breeze, Planet Oat and more. Job Summary: The Operator III is responsible to safely and efficiently perform duties in Batching, Processing, Separating, and Receiving to ensure service to the fillers in a manner that is consistent with HP Hood LLC standards. Essential Duties and Responsibilities: - Perform all tasks and functions related to operating and cleaning in Batching, Separating, Receiving, and Processing Areas. - Support the continued development of the processing master sanitation program. - Organize daily processing schedule to ensure batched product is available to maintain proper production flow. - Verify proper powders are selected and added to formulas. - Verify powders selected are recorded properly (weight, lot #, and batch #); Ensure all documentation is completed accurately and timely. - Clean and sanitize all process related equipment, which will include but not be limited to raw tanks, blend tanks, and lines. - Daily operation of multiple processors, batching equipment, separator, and receiving areas in a production setting to include the startup, shutdown, and sanitation of all related equipment according to Standard Operating Procedures (SOP). - Work in a safe manner in compliance with Federal, State and company Good Manufacturing Practices (GMP), SOP, and administrative policies. - Support SQF by maintaining food safety and food quality through completing job tasks and maintaining the work area in a sanitary manner. - Obtain State Milk Receiver License. - Operate equipment and know all circuits to ensure proper hookups are made. - Keep accurate logs, paperwork and charts. - Submit work orders and maintain equipment. - Consistently meet production efficiencies and targets. - Complete paperwork as per government regulations and HP Hood requirements. - Safely operate all assigned equipment following policies and procedures. - Maintain communication with team members, cross functional partners, and other crews. - Compliance with all plant safety policies and procedures. - Responsible for general plant cleanliness with the expectation of being inspection ready 24/7. - Reports all safety concerns/incidents promptly to a Supervisor, Lead or Manager. - May be required to assist in facilitation of training for new or existing operators in the qualification process. • All other assignments given by Supervision. We are unable to assist with sponsorship at this time. ## About HP Hood ## Company Overview - **One-liner**: HP Hood is one of the largest dairy processors in the United States, producing and distributing a wide range of dairy products including milk, ice cream, cottage cheese, sour cream, and cream under its own and licensed brands. - **Entity Type**: Private (family-owned by the Kaneb Family) - **Headquarters**: Lynnfield, Massachusetts, United States - **Founded**: 1846 - **Founders**: Harvey Perley Hood ## Core Business - **Primary industry**: Food and Beverage Manufacturing (Dairy) - **Target customers**: B2B (grocery retailers, food service distributors) and B2C (consumers) - **Mission or purpose statement**: The company emphasizes a commitment to quality, community, and innovation. Their founder's pledge is that "good enough never was," and they focus on providing fresh, premium-quality dairy products while supporting the communities where they operate. ## Products & Services - **Hood® Brand**: A full line of fluid milk, ice cream, cottage cheese, sour cream, cream, and other dairy products; the number-one dairy brand in New England. - **Heluva Good!®**: A brand of dips, cheeses, and sour cream with a national presence. - **LACTAID® Brand dairy products**: Licensed lactose-free milk, ice cream, and cottage cheese. - **Blue Diamond Almond Breeze®**: Licensed almond milk and dairy-alternative products. - **Other licensed and regional brands**: The company also produces and distributes other licensed products. ## Market Standing - **Valuation/Market Cap**: Not publicly available (private company). HP Hood was listed at #169 on the Forbes "America's Largest Private Companies" list for 2025. - **Key Metric**: Annual Revenue of approximately $2.1 billion (per LinkedIn estimate) to over $3 billion (per Forbes and company statements). - **Notable Investors/Partners**: The Kaneb Family (owners). Key partners include license holders like Lactaid and Blue Diamond, and major retail and food service customers across the U.S. - **Growth Signals**: The company has 12 manufacturing plants across the United States and is a top dairy brand in New England.
